The Hibernian Orchestra (formerly the Hibernian Chamber Orchestra) is an orchestra based in Dublin, Ireland.

Founded in 1981,[citation needed] the orchestra performs extensively in Dublin and increasingly is bringing music to regional towns across Ireland.[tone] Its repertoire ranges from early works to newly commissioned pieces.[1] Notable artists who have performed with the orchestra include Finghin Collins,[2] Philip Martin,[3] and Ioana Petcu-Colan.[citation needed]
